The Lotos Club

Description

Designed by architect Richard Hunt as a private residence, the Lotos Club is an Individual NYC Landmark and was constructed in 1900. When an exterior restoration and mechanical system replacement was required, Nicholson & Galloway was contracted to perform the following work:

  • 4,375 square feet of brick and limestone cleaning
  • 66 linear feet of parapet and spandrel beam reconstruction
  • 142 linear feet of iron & brass railing restoration
  • 50 linear feet of copper cheneau replication
  • 775 square feet of new slate and 4 copper dormers restored
  • 3,300 square feet of torch applied Siplast roofing
  • Replacement of all rooftop mechanicals and dunnage
